Spindle bearings are a type of angular contact ball bearings that are specifically designed for high-precision applications. They have a unique design that enables them to support extremely high axial and radial loads while maintaining their accuracy and stability.
Spindle bearings are commonly used in machine tools, including grinding machines, milling machines, and lathes. They are also used in electric motors, generators, and other high-speed rotating equipment where precise control and stability are critical.
One of the key features of spindle bearings is their high stiffness, which allows them to resist deformation and maintain their accuracy even under heavy loads. This is achieved through the use of specialized materials and heat treatments that enhance their strength and durability.
Spindle bearings also have a unique cage design that allows them to operate at high speeds without generating excessive heat or friction. This helps to extend their service life and reduce maintenance costs.
